数据库用什么解释比较好
-
数据库是一种用于存储、管理和检索数据的软件系统。它可以用来组织和存储大量数据,并提供对这些数据的高效访问。在选择数据库时,需要考虑以下几个因素:
-
数据类型和结构:不同的数据库系统支持不同的数据类型和数据结构。例如,关系型数据库适用于结构化数据,而文档型数据库适用于非结构化数据。因此,在选择数据库时,需要根据数据的特点来确定最合适的数据库类型。
-
性能和可伸缩性:数据库的性能和可伸缩性是评估其适用性的重要指标。性能指标包括响应时间、并发处理能力和吞吐量等。可伸缩性指的是数据库系统能够有效地处理和存储大规模数据集。因此,在选择数据库时,需要考虑数据库的性能和可伸缩性是否满足业务需求。
-
安全性:数据库的安全性是非常重要的,特别是对于存储敏感数据的应用程序。安全性包括数据加密、身份验证和访问控制等方面。因此,在选择数据库时,需要确保数据库提供了足够的安全功能,以保护数据的机密性和完整性。
-
可用性和可靠性:数据库的可用性和可靠性是指数据库系统能够持续提供服务,并保证数据的可靠性和一致性。可用性方面包括备份和恢复机制,以及故障转移和负载均衡等功能。因此,在选择数据库时,需要考虑数据库的可用性和可靠性是否满足业务需求。
-
成本和开发者支持:最后,成本和开发者支持也是选择数据库时需要考虑的因素。不同的数据库系统有不同的许可费用和支持政策。同时,选择一种有活跃的开发者社区和良好文档支持的数据库系统,可以更好地解决问题和提升开发效率。
综上所述,选择数据库时需要综合考虑数据类型和结构、性能和可伸缩性、安全性、可用性和可靠性,以及成本和开发者支持等因素。根据具体的业务需求和技术要求,选择最适合的数据库系统来解释数据是比较好的。
1年前 -
-
数据库是用来存储和管理数据的一种软件系统。它可以提供高效的数据访问和管理功能,为用户提供了方便的数据存取接口,同时还能保证数据的安全性和一致性。数据库可以将数据组织成逻辑上的表格形式,用户可以通过查询语言对数据进行检索和操作。
数据库可以用几种不同的方式来解释,这取决于不同的角度和需求。以下是几种常见的解释方法:
-
数据库是一个文件系统:从文件系统的角度来看,数据库可以被看作是一种专门用于存储和管理数据的文件系统。它提供了更高级别的抽象和功能,比如数据的结构化、索引、事务处理等。
-
数据库是一个数据仓库:从数据仓库的角度来看,数据库可以被看作是一个集中存储和管理大量数据的仓库。它可以支持多种数据类型和数据结构,并提供强大的查询和分析功能,帮助用户从数据中提取有价值的信息。
-
数据库是一个应用程序的后端:从应用程序的角度来看,数据库可以被看作是应用程序的后端,用于存储和管理应用程序的数据。它提供了数据持久化的功能,保证了数据的安全性和一致性,并提供了数据访问的接口供应用程序调用。
-
数据库是一个数据管理系统:从数据管理系统的角度来看,数据库可以被看作是一个完整的数据管理系统,包括数据的存储、检索、更新、删除等功能。它提供了数据的结构化和组织化能力,并通过事务处理和并发控制等机制保证了数据的完整性和一致性。
总之,数据库是一种用于存储和管理数据的软件系统,可以从不同的角度和需求来解释。无论从哪个角度来看,数据库都是一个重要的工具,为用户提供了高效的数据管理和访问功能,帮助用户更好地利用和管理数据。
1年前 -
-
数据库是一个用来存储和管理数据的系统。它可以提供数据的持久化存储,可以方便地存取和管理数据。数据库可以用来存储各种类型的数据,如文本、图像、音频等。数据库系统通过使用结构化的数据模型和查询语言,使得用户可以方便地对数据进行操作和管理。
数据库系统主要包含以下几个组成部分:
-
数据库管理系统(DBMS):是一个软件系统,用来管理数据库。它提供了一套操作数据库的接口和工具,可以对数据库进行创建、修改、查询和删除等操作。
-
数据库:是一个按照一定的数据模型组织起来的数据集合。数据库中的数据按照一定的规则进行组织和存储,可以通过DBMS进行访问和操作。
-
数据模型:用来描述数据之间的关系和约束规则。常用的数据模型有层次模型、网络模型、关系模型和面向对象模型等。
-
数据库查询语言(SQL):是一种专门用来操作数据库的语言。SQL可以用来创建数据库、创建表、插入、更新和删除数据,以及查询数据库中的数据等。
数据库的设计和使用需要遵循一定的原则和规范,以下是一些常用的数据库设计和使用的方法和操作流程:
-
数据库需求分析:首先需要明确数据库的需求,包括数据类型、数据量、数据访问频率等。根据需求分析结果,确定数据库的结构和功能。
-
数据库设计:根据需求分析的结果,设计数据库的结构和关系模型。可以使用ER图(实体-关系图)来描述数据库中的实体和实体之间的关系。
-
数据库创建:根据设计的结构和模型,使用SQL语句创建数据库和表。可以使用DBMS提供的图形界面工具或命令行工具来创建数据库。
-
数据插入和更新:使用SQL语句插入和更新数据。可以使用INSERT语句向表中插入新的数据,使用UPDATE语句更新表中的数据。
-
数据查询:使用SQL语句查询数据库中的数据。可以使用SELECT语句查询满足特定条件的数据,可以使用ORDER BY语句对查询结果进行排序,还可以使用JOIN语句进行多表查询。
-
数据库备份和恢复:定期对数据库进行备份,以防止数据丢失。可以使用DBMS提供的备份工具进行备份,以及使用恢复工具进行数据恢复。
-
数据库优化:根据数据库的性能情况,对数据库进行优化。可以通过索引、分区、数据压缩等方式提高数据库的查询和存储性能。
总结:数据库是一个用来存储和管理数据的系统,它提供了一套操作数据库的接口和工具。数据库的设计和使用需要遵循一定的原则和规范,包括需求分析、数据库设计、数据库创建、数据插入和更新、数据查询、数据库备份和恢复以及数据库优化等步骤。通过合理的数据库设计和使用,可以方便地存取和管理数据,提高数据的安全性和性能。
1年前 -